@charset "UTF-8";
/* CSS Document */
html { background-color: #e9f1f9;}
body { margin-left: auto; margin-right: auto; }
#global {
	position: absolute;
	left: 50%;
	margin-left: -470px;
	width: 950px;
	min-height: 600px;
	overflow: none;
	top: 24px;
}

a { font-family:Verdana, Arial, Helvetica, sans-serif; color:#FF0099; font-size:11px; font-weight:bold; text-decoration:none;  }
a:hover { font-family:Verdana, Arial, Helvetica, sans-serif; color:#CCCCCC; font-size:11px; font-weight:bold; text-decoration:none;  }
h1 {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; color:#FF0099;  }

#titre { color:#0099FF; font-family:Verdana; font-size:14px; background-color:#FFFFFF; border-top:#CCCCCC 1px solid; border-right:#CCCCCC 1px solid; border-left:#CCCCCC 1px solid;   }
#contenu { color:#666666; font-family:Verdana; font-size:11px; background-color:#FFFFFF; border-right:#CCCCCC 1px solid; border-left:#CCCCCC 1px solid;   }
#basdepage { color:#666666; height:50px; font-family:Verdana; font-size:11px; background-color:#FFFFFF; border-right:#CCCCCC 1px solid; border-left:#CCCCCC 1px solid; border-bottom:#CCCCCC 1px solid;   }
#prix { border:#CCCCCC 1px solid; text-align:center; }

#fond { width: 950px; height: 800px; background-image:url(../images/bgd_grand_format.jpg); background-repeat:no-repeat; }

#menu { font-family:Verdana, Arial, Helvetica, sans-serif; color:#0099FF; font-size:11px; font-weight:bold; text-decoration:none;  }
#menu a { font-family:Verdana, Arial, Helvetica, sans-serif; color:#FF0099; font-size:11px; font-weight:bold; text-decoration:none;  }
#menu a:hover { color:#FF6699;  }

#colong { width: 950px; float:left;  }
#colg { width: 70px; height:100px; float:left; }
#centre { width: 800px; float:left;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#666666;  }

#intro { border-left:1px solid #CCCCCC; font-size:14px; border-right:1px solid #CCCCCC; background-color:#FFFFFF; }
#col { width: 395px; height: 600px;  }

#foot {  width: 950px; height: 30px; float:left;  }
#foot a { text-decoration:none; color:#666666; font-size:9px; }
#foot a:hover { text-decoration:none; color:#FF0099; font-size:9px; }

ul { list-style-type: circle; }

#formdevis { float:left; border: 1px solid #CCCCCC;}
#idee { float:left;  background-image:url(../images/fond-idee-impression.jpg); background-repeat:no-repeat; border-bottom: 1px #FF0099 solid;}
#idee2 { float:left;  background-image:url(../images/idee-impression-grand.jpg); background-repeat:no-repeat; border-bottom: 1px #FF0099 solid;}

#serie { float:left; width: 400px; }

a.infoBulle { position: relative}
a.infoBulle span { display: none; }
a.infoBulle:hover {text-decoration: none; background: none; /* correction d'un bug IE */ }
a.infoBulle:hover span {top:-300px; left:-300px; display: inline; position: absolute; z-index: 500; border:0; padding: 0px; text-decoration: none; filter:alpha(opacity=80); -moz-opacity:1.00; }
#chrono { border: 2px solid #FFFFCC;  }